The Bridge offers supportive housing and behavioral health services to vulnerable New Yorkers facing behavioral health and substance use challenges. We provide individuals with the tools they need to pursue their dreams and live meaningful lives. The Bridge envisions a world where adults experiencing serious mental illness can live and thrive within their communities. As a recognized leader in developing and operating supportive housing and community-based programs, The Bridge has 70 years of experience helping New Yorkers with mental illness, including those affected by homelessness, incarceration, and institutionalization. Scope of Position: The SOS team, consisting of a Director, Assistant Director, Clinicians, Care Managers, a Nurse, and a Peer Specialist, will apply the evidence-based Critical Time Intervention (CTI) model to support participants transitioning from the street to stable housing. The Case Manager will engage in community outreach, assist with daily living skills, accompany participants to appointments, and advocate for them against discrimination or healthcare inequities. The role emphasizes member choice, harm reduction, and person-centered care. SOS teams will continue supporting participants post-housing placement for several months to ensure stability and well-being. The position requires fieldwork, on-call coverage, flexible hours, and offers training in CTI and professional development opportunities.
